Regional Analysis of Japan Telescopic Boom MEVP Market
Japan’s MEVP market exhibits significant regional variation influenced by economic activity, industrial density, and infrastructure development. The Tokyo metropolitan region remains the dominant market, benefiting from high construction activity, government infrastructure projects, and a dense concentration of industrial facilities. This region accounts for approximately 40% of the national market share, driven by urban renewal and disaster resilience investments.
In contrast, industrial hubs like Osaka and Nagoya are experiencing accelerated growth due to expanding manufacturing sectors and logistics infrastructure. These regions are increasingly adopting advanced MEVP solutions to meet safety and productivity standards. Rural and less-developed areas, while slower in adoption, present emerging opportunities as government initiatives promote regional connectivity and infrastructure upgrades. Overall, the market’s growth rate varies regionally, with urban centers leading due to higher project volumes and technological adoption, while peripheral regions are poised for future expansion.

Key Players Analysis in Japan Telescopic Boom MEVP Market
The market features a mix of global giants such as JLG Industries, Genie (Terex), and Haulotte, alongside regional leaders like Tadano and Kato Works. Over the past five years, these players have reported revenue growth averaging 8-12%, driven by technological innovation and strategic acquisitions. Leading firms focus on product diversification, integrating IoT and automation, with R&D investments constituting approximately 4-6% of revenue to sustain competitive differentiation.
Regional revenue distribution shows a strong concentration in Japan’s urban centers, with emerging challengers expanding into peripheral markets. Pricing strategies vary from premium offerings emphasizing safety and technology to cost-effective models targeting rental fleets. Disruptive startups specializing in remote operation and predictive analytics are beginning to influence the competitive landscape, prompting incumbents to accelerate innovation cycles and pursue M&A to consolidate market share.
